appleiphonelawsuit.com solicits class action case

appleiphonelawsuit.gif

The Law Office of M. Van Smith and Damian R. Fernandez in California has opened a website to solicit clients who are interested in suing Apple over its iPhone, according to Information Week via The Inquirer.

From their website www.appleiphonelawsuit.com

If you are a California resident and are interested in joining to file an iPhone class action lawsuit against Apple Inc., you should contact the Law Office of Damian R. Fernandez immediately if any one of the following categories applies to you:

1. You own an iPhone and you want to transfer to a wireless carrier other than AT&T. You fall into this category even if you did not unlock your iPhone or have your iPhone disabled by an iPhone update.

2. Your iPhone was disabled, malfunctioned, or you had third-party applications erased after you downloaded iPhone update 1.1.1.

3. You contacted Apple to repair your iPhone and Apple refused to honor your warranty because you did any one the following: (1) unlocked your iPhone, or (2) installed a third party application.

4. You incurred a cancellation fee from your previous wireless carrier when you transferred to AT&T’s wireless service.

5. You incurred roaming charges while travelling abroad with your iPhone.

6. You purchased a third-party warranty at extra cost for your iPhone because of Apple’s released statement that it will not honor warranties on unlocked iPhones.

You do not have to be in all of these categories, just one or more than one.
